About the role and why it’s unique:

  • Lead the design and execution of promotional campaigns to maximize customer retention across various verticals.
  • Collaborate with cross-functional teams to create and optimize retention strategies, tailored to specific customer journeys.
  • Utilize SQL to analyze and extract customer data, providing insights to shape campaign strategies and improve performance.
  • Own the execution of retention-focused initiatives, including but not limited to CRM, customer engagement, and targeted campaigns.
  • Work directly with managers to align promotional efforts across tent pole events, customer engagement, CRM, and sportsbook verticals.
  • Take ownership of initiatives from start to finish, ensuring cross-functional alignment and campaign success.

Who you are:

  • 3+ years of experience in sports gaming or related industries, with a focus on promotions and retention.
  • Strong experience using SQL to analyze customer data, support decision-making, and optimize campaigns.
  • Understand the different components of customer journeys and know how to tailor strategies for retention.
  • Thrive in a fast-paced environment and enjoy taking ownership of projects from end-to-end.
  • Passionate about sports and the gaming industry, with a solid understanding of customer behaviors and how to engage fans.

Even better if you have:

  • Experience with CRM tools like Optimove or Braze.
  • Proficiency in data analysis and reporting using platforms like Looker, Sigma, or similar.
  • Strong knowledge of promotional strategies for sportsbooks or similar industries.


Our target starting base salary range for this position is between $93,500 and $110,000, plus target equity. The starting base salary will depend on a number of factors including the candidate’s skills and experience, among other things.

What you need to know about the San Francisco Tech Scene

San Francisco and the surrounding Bay Area attracts more startup funding than any other region in the world. Home to Stanford University and UC Berkeley, leading VC firms and several of the world’s most valuable companies, the Bay Area is the place to go for anyone looking to make it big in the tech industry. That said, San Francisco has a lot to offer beyond technology thanks to a thriving art and music scene, excellent food and a short drive to several of the country’s most beautiful recreational areas.

Key Facts About San Francisco Tech

  • Number of Tech Workers: 365,500; 13.9%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
  • Major Tech Employers: Google, Apple, Salesforce, Meta
  • Key Industries: Artificial intelligence, cloud computing, fintech, consumer technology, software
  • Funding Landscape: $50.5 billion in venture capital funding in 2024 (Pitchbook)
  • Notable Investors: Sequoia Capital, Andreessen Horowitz, Bessemer Venture Partners, Greylock Partners, Khosla Ventures, Kleiner Perkins
  • Research Centers and Universities: Stanford University; University of California, Berkeley; University of San Francisco; Santa Clara University; Ames Research Center; Center for AI Safety; California Institute for Regenerative Medicine
